How to Convert Kip to Kilonewton

1 kip = 4.44822 kilonewtons

Kilonewton = Kip × 4.44822

Example: 1245 kip × 4.44822 = 5538 kN

Reverse Conversion

To convert kilonewtons back to kips:

  • Remember, 1 kilonewton equals 0.224809 kips.
  • To convert 5538 kN to kip, multiply 5538 x 0.224809, resulting in 1245 kip.
